Selecting the Right AR-15 Rifle Build Kit

Before you begin your AR15 rifle build kit, it’s essential to choose the right build kit for your needs. AR-15 rifle build kits come in various configurations, so consider the following factors:

Caliber: Determine the caliber you want for your AR-15, such as .223 Remington/5.56mm NATO, 6.5 Grendel, or .300 Blackout. Ensure that your kit includes the appropriate barrel and components for your chosen caliber.

Type: Decide whether you want a complete upper receiver assembly, a stripped lower receiver, or a combination of both. Some kits may also include a lower parts kit (LPK) and stock assembly.

Budget: Consider your budget and what components are included in the kit. Determine if you need to purchase any additional accessories or parts separately.

Barrel Length and Profile: Choose the barrel length and profile that aligns with your intended use, whether it’s for precision shooting, home defense, or general-purpose use.

Handguard: Decide if you want a free-floating or drop-in handguard and whether it should have a picatinny rail for accessory attachment.

Assembly Process

Once you have selected the right ar15 rifle build kit, follow these steps to assemble your rifle:

Gather Tools and Work Area: You’ll need basic tools such as armorers’ wrenches, pin punches, vise blocks, and a torque wrench. Ensure you have a clean and organized work area.

Safety First: Always follow safety precautions when handling firearms and components. Keep the work area well-ventilated and free from obstructions.

Lower Receiver Assembly:

Start with the lower receiver, where the trigger group, magazine release, safety selector, and pistol grip will be installed.
Follow the manufacturer’s instructions and use the included LPK for guidance.
Ensure all components are properly seated and torqued to the recommended specifications.

Upper Receiver Assembly:

Assemble the upper receiver, including attaching the barrel, gas block, and gas tube.
Ensure that the barrel nut is properly tightened to the specified torque.
Install the bolt carrier group (BCG) and charging handle.

Complete the Build:

Mate the upper and lower receivers, ensuring a snug fit.
Attach the handguard, stock assembly, and any other accessories according to your preferences.
Perform function checks to ensure the rifle operates safely and reliably.

Legal Considerations

When building your AR-15 rifle using a build kit, it’s crucial to be aware of the legal considerations:

Serialized Lower Receiver: The lower receiver is the only part of the AR-15 considered a firearm and is subject to federal and state regulations, including background checks and age restrictions.

State and Local Laws: Be aware of your state and local firearm laws, which can vary significantly and may impose restrictions on features like magazine capacity, barrel length, and overall firearm configurations.

Serial Number: Depending on your location, you may need to apply for and engrave a serial number on your self-assembled AR-15 lower receiver to comply with local regulations.

With the rise in popularity of meat delivery services, consumers now have the convenience of having high-quality cuts of meat delivered right to their doorstep. However, choosing the right meat delivery service can be a crucial decision to ensure you get the best value and quality for your money. 

Here are five important questions to ask your meat delivery service before making your selection:

  1. Where Does Your Meat Come From?

Knowing the source of your meat is essential for both ethical and health reasons. Ask the delivery service about the origin of their meat products. Reputable providers will be transparent about their sourcing, often highlighting partnerships with responsible and sustainable farms. 

  1. What Is the Quality and Freshness Guarantee?

A top-notch meat delivery service should stand behind the quality and freshness of their products. Inquire about their guarantee or return policy in case you receive meat that doesn’t meet your expectations. 

  1. How Is the Meat Packaged and Delivered?

Understanding the packaging and delivery process is crucial to ensure your meat arrives in optimal condition. Ask about the packaging materials used, whether they employ sustainable practices, and if the meat is shipped frozen or fresh. Proper packaging and cold-chain logistics are essential to maintain the integrity of your meat during transit.

  1. Can I Customize My Orders?

Every customer’s preference and need are unique. A great meat delivery service should offer the flexibility to customize your orders. Inquire whether you can select specific cuts, portion sizes, or meat types according to your dietary preferences and requirements. 

  1. What Are the Subscription Options and Pricing?

Understanding the pricing structure and subscription options is vital for budget-conscious consumers. Ask about subscription plans, discounts, and any hidden fees. Determine whether the service offers one-time purchases or subscription models that cater to your frequency and quantity preferences.
